YY08 JUT is a 2008 Peugeot Expert in Silver with a 1,997c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 65%.
Across all 2008 Peugeot Expert models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.2% with a typical mileage of 108,879 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Peugeot Expert f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 34,152 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YY08 JUT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Peugeot Expert typ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 18 years old, this Peugeot Expert is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
